Matheus Oliveira Martins

3×3 · top 1.1% of 284,439 all-time · competing since July 2022 · 2022MART35

Matheus Oliveira Martins has been competing for 4 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 6.79, set at Ligerin Goiânia 2025, puts him in the top 1.1%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 39th in Brazil. Until November 2010, no official 3×3 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 12 competitions since July 2022, he has put 499 official solves on the record across eleven events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one; 54%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ds hold a tighter spread. His 3×3 best has come down from 34.43 in July 2022 to 6.79, an 80% improvement. Matheus has entered twelve competitions, more competitions than 94%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
